 1Co 3:2 I have fed you with milk, and not with meat: for hitherto ye were not able to bear it, neither yet now are ye able.

1Co 3:3 For ye are yet carnal: for whereas there is among you envying, and strife, and divisions, are ye not carnal, and walk as men?


Jas 3:16 For where envying and strife is, there is confusion and every evil work.

Jas 3:17 But the wisdom that is from above is first pure, then peaceable, gentle, and easy to be intreated, full of mercy and good fruits, without partiality, and without hypocrisy.


In these verses, James is emphasizing the contrast between earthly wisdom, characterized by envy and strife, which leads to confusion and evil deeds, and divine wisdom, which is pure, peaceable, gentle, merciful, and sincere. James encourages his readers to seek and embrace the wisdom that comes from above, as it fosters positive qualities and actions.
